> Can stock losses from short term gains be used to offset
> long term gains.


Of course you'd first offset short term gains with those
(short term) losses, but then if there are no further short
term gains you apply the losses against long term gains.

Gerneral rule is you cancel like gains first short gains
against short losses, long gains against long losses.

Pub 550 explains in greater detail.
